Output 35481be0790cd77f30a8075f933a4c26f26eeead036a976bdfd3ec24340f55b0:0

value
2956056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c016ed663175c2c2be2fd4cfceedd40b94b731a7 OP_EQUAL
address
3KCh8PrBR7AGLwEkkfHc2KY4hN9if77E2N
transaction
35481be0790cd77f30a8075f933a4c26f26eeead036a976bdfd3ec24340f55b0
spent
true